The post on LS430 Aux input has kicked me into action on something I have been meaning to do for some time, fitting a USB input to the standard LS400 stereo. It also comes with integrated Bluetooth for the phone.

The unit is the Dension Gateway Lite BT and cost just over a hundred quid.

It plugs in to the CD input and they seem to know the score on the rather non standard Lexus wiring - this I'll confirm when I fit it.

Well, I tried to fit this on Sunday, but the multi plugs are different - 12 pin not 14 like mine, though they look the same at a glance.

I have emailed the manufacturers, who now tell me that it only fits the US version, and they do not have a conversion loom.

They should make this clear on their site - Now I must try to get my money back.

They have responded quickly so far, so I hope there won't be any problems.
